Provides medically prescribed consultative and therapeutic services within scope of practice in order to restore function and prevent disability for clients or patients with musculoskeletal, neuromuscular and cardiopulmonary disorders. Performs responsibilities in accordance with department and Hospital Policies, state, federal and regulatory requirements: Title 22 Section 70517, 70519. Functions according to professional practice as an integral member of the interdisciplinary care team.
Education and Work Experience
Bachelor or Master Degree in Occupational Therapy.
Current state Occupational Therapy certification/license.
Current BCLS (AHA) certificate
National Board for Certification Occupational Therapy certification, AOTA and OTAC preferred.
